History
Name | Sodium | Iridium |
History | The element Sodium was discovered by H. Davy in year 1807 in United Kingdom. Sodium derived its name from the English word soda (natrium in Latin). | The element Iridium was discovered by S. Tennant in year 1803 in France and United Kingdom. Iridium derived its name from Iris, the Greek goddess of the rainbow. |
Discovery | H. Davy (1807) | S. Tennant (1803) |
Isolated | H. Davy (1807) | S. Tennant (1803) |
